This Year's Model Updates:

The Mazda 6 is mostly unchanged for 2008. The Sport Wagon model has been discontinued, leaving only two body styles, and the Touring and Grand Touring can now only be equipped with the six-speed automatic. Minor feature adjustments, such as larger wheels for the Sport trim and a standard Bose audio system for the Touring, round out the changes.

Pros:
  • Fun to drive, smooth power delivery, attractive design inside and out, availability of versatile hatchback body style.
Cons:
  • Engines are less powerful and fuel efficient than competitors, tight rear seat accommodations, stability control not available.
